Following the sudden and tragic deaths of her parents, Faye Huntington's arrival as a debutant in the 1813 social season has been halted as she is now forced to move across the city of London to live with her godmother, Lady Danbury.

As Faye stands on the sidelines, supporting the Duke of Hastings chaotic courting of a certain Bridgerton sister, she will soon realise that there is still much fun to be had in Grosvenor Square.
